Study Summary

The purpose of this study is to evaluate the safety, tolerability, pharmacokinetic, and pharmacodynamic effects of multiple doses of intravenous DT-216 in adult patients with Friedrich Ataxia.

Primary Outcome

Frequency of treatment emergent adverse events (TEAEs)
